Fenton-like oxidation of reactive black 5 solution using Fe-rice husk ash catalyst
In this work, the decolorization of the azo dye Reactive Black 5 (RB5) was studied, making use of a Fenton-like oxidation process. For that, hydrogen peroxide (H2O) activation was achieved by means of one supported material-based catalysts, which have been immobilized with 0.070 wt. % of Fe (III)...
